In Medical Situations, What are Gamma Rays used for? Where do they Excel and Fail in?
Author: eric_galvaoAnswer:
-Gamma Rays are Transmitted by Pretty much every part of the Body, so that means you can Detect it from Outside the Body -This can be done via Radio tracers, Radioactive Isotopes that can be Injected or Swollen, and can Emit Gamma Rays -This means, for examples, if you put the Tracer in a Molecule, Glucose, it can see how much Absorption of that Molecule is happening, giving you Answers
